Class RasterImageExtension

Class RasterImageExtension

ชื่อพื้นที่: Aspose.Imaging.MagicWand การประกอบ: Aspose.Imaging.dll (25.4.0)

คลาสที่มีวิธีการขยายหน้ากากสําหรับ Aspose.Imaging.RasterImage

public static class RasterImageExtension

Inheritance

object RasterImageExtension

อนุญาโตตุลาการ

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Methods

ApplyMask(RasterImage, IImageMask)

ใช้ Aspose.Imaging.MagicWand.ImageMasks.IImageMask ไปยัง Aspose.Imaging.RasterImage

public static void ApplyMask(RasterImage image, IImageMask mask)

Parameters

image RasterImage

รูปภาพที่จะนํามาใช้หน้ากาก

mask IImageMask

หน้ากากที่จะใช้

Exceptions

ArgumentException

ระยําเมื่อขนาดหน้ากากเล็กกว่าภาพ

SelectMask(RasterImage, MagicWandSettings)

สร้าง Aspose.Imaging.MagicWand.ImageMasks.ImageBitMask ด้วยตัวเลือกของพิกเซลที่มีสีคล้ายกับสีของจุดคํานวณขึ้นอยู่กับ Aspose.Imaging.MagicWand.MagicWandSettings

public static ImageBitMask SelectMask(RasterImage source, MagicWandSettings settings = null)

Parameters

source RasterImage

ภาพ Raster สําหรับ algorithm เพื่อทํางานผ่าน

settings MagicWandSettings

การตั้งค่าที่ใช้ในการประมวลผลการเลือกรวมถึงจุดคํานวณ

Returns

ImageBitMask

ใหม่ Aspose.Imaging.MagicWand.ImageMasks.ImageBitMask.

 แบบไทย